当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

搭建vps主机教程,VPS搭建虚拟主机教程,从入门到精通

搭建vps主机教程,VPS搭建虚拟主机教程,从入门到精通

本教程全面解析VPS主机搭建,涵盖从入门到精通的步骤,助您轻松搭建虚拟主机,掌握VPS管理技巧。...

本教程全面解析VPS主机搭建,涵盖从入门到精通的步骤,助您轻松搭建虚拟主机,掌握VPS管理技巧。

随着互联网的快速发展,越来越多的企业和个人开始关注虚拟主机服务,VPS(虚拟专用服务器)作为虚拟主机的一种,以其高性价比、灵活配置、安全稳定等特点受到广泛关注,本文将为您详细讲解如何搭建VPS虚拟主机,让您轻松入门并精通。

VPS搭建虚拟主机教程

准备工作

(1)购买VPS:您需要选择一家可靠的VPS服务商,购买适合自己的VPS产品,购买时,请关注VPS的CPU、内存、硬盘、带宽等配置,确保满足您的需求。

(2)获取VPS登录信息:购买成功后,服务商会发送VPS的登录信息,包括IP地址、用户名、密码等。

搭建vps主机教程,VPS搭建虚拟主机教程,从入门到精通

图片来源于网络,如有侵权联系删除

登录VPS

(1)使用SSH客户端:打开SSH客户端(如PuTTY、Xshell等),输入VPS的IP地址、用户名和密码,连接到VPS。

(2)使用远程桌面:部分VPS服务商提供远程桌面功能,您可以通过远程桌面软件(如TeamViewer、AnyDesk等)连接到VPS。

安装操作系统

(1)选择操作系统:根据您的需求,选择合适的操作系统,如CentOS、Ubuntu、Debian等。

(2)安装操作系统:在SSH客户端中,使用以下命令安装操作系统:

以CentOS为例:

sudo yum install -y centos-release
sudo yum install -y centos-base

(3)重启VPS:安装完成后,重启VPS,使操作系统生效。

安装LAMP环境

(1)安装Apache:使用以下命令安装Apache服务器:

sudo yum install -y httpd

(2)安装MySQL:使用以下命令安装MySQL数据库:

sudo yum install -y mariadb-server

(3)安装PHP:使用以下命令安装PHP:

sudo yum install -y php php-mysql

配置Apache和MySQL

(1)配置Apache:

搭建vps主机教程,VPS搭建虚拟主机教程,从入门到精通

图片来源于网络,如有侵权联系删除

sudo vi /etc/httpd/conf/httpd.conf

找到以下行,并修改为:

ServerName yourdomain.com

(2)配置MySQL:

sudo vi /etc/my.cnf

找到以下行,并修改为:

[mysqld]
bind-address = 0.0.0.0

创建网站

(1)创建网站目录:在VPS中创建一个网站目录,如:

sudo mkdir /var/www/yourdomain.com

(2)创建数据库:在MySQL中创建一个数据库,如:

mysql -u root -p

输入密码后,执行以下命令:

CREATE DATABASE yourdatabase;

(3)上传网站文件:将网站文件上传到VPS中的网站目录。

(4)配置虚拟主机:在Apache中配置虚拟主机,如:

sudo vi /etc/httpd/conf.d/yourdomain.com.conf
<VirtualHost *:80>
    ServerAdmin admin@yourdomain.com
    ServerName yourdomain.com
    DocumentRoot /var/www/yourdomain.com
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

重启Apache

sudo systemctl restart httpd

测试网站

在浏览器中输入您的域名,如果成功显示网站内容,则表示VPS虚拟主机搭建成功。

通过以上教程,您已经成功搭建了VPS虚拟主机,在实际应用中,您可以根据需求对VPS进行优化和配置,提高网站性能和安全性,祝您在使用VPS虚拟主机过程中一切顺利!

黑狐家游戏

发表评论

最新文章